In The Rapidly Evolving Electric Vehicle (Ev) Industry, The Efficient Thermal Management Of Insulated Gate Bipolar Transistor (Igbt) Modules Is Paramount. These Modules Are Critical For Power Conversion But Generate Significant Heat, Necessitating Advanced Heatsink Solutions To Ensure Optimal Performance And Longevity.

From My Experience In The Automotive Sector, I'Ve Observed That Manufacturers Are Increasingly Focusing On The Development Of Both Air-Cooled And Water-Cooled Heatsink Solutions. Air-Cooled Heatsinks, While Simpler And More Cost-Effective, Are Suitable For Lower Power Applications. In Contrast, Water-Cooled Heatsinks Offer Superior Thermal Performance, Making Them Ideal For High-Power Ev Applications Where Efficient Heat Dissipation Is Critical.
The Market Is Also Witnessing A Strategic Shift In Distribution Channels. Original Equipment Manufacturers (Oems) Currently Dominate, Supplying Heatsinks Tailored For New Vehicle Models. Their Close Collaboration With Automakers Ensures That Heatsink Designs Meet Stringent Performance And Reliability Standards. However, The Aftermarket Segment Is Gaining Traction, Driven By The Need For Replacement And Upgraded Heatsinks In Existing Evs. As The Global Fleet Of Electric Vehicles Ages, Consumers Are Becoming More Aware Of The Importance Of Efficient Thermal Management, Leading To Increased Demand In The Aftermarket.
Geographically, Asia Holds The Largest Market Share, Accounting For About 51% Of The Global Demand, Followed By Europe And North America With Shares Of Approximately 31% And 17%, Respectively. This Regional Distribution Aligns With The Rapid Adoption Of Electric Vehicles In These Areas, Supported By Favorable Government Policies And Increasing Consumer Awareness Of Sustainable Transportation Options.
